One UI 3.0 (Android 11) now available for Samsung Galaxy Note 10 in PH

The Samsung Galaxy Note 10 has recently received the latest software update, One UI 3.0, that’s based on Android 11.

Those who own the Samsung Galaxy Note 10 may download the software update through the smartphone’s settings. The software update, which has a total of 2GB of data download, comes with a redesigned UI. It has added touch and holds for adding an associated widget, more categories in the Dynamic Lockscreen, Quick Panel for checking conversations, warnings and blocking options for websites with many pop-ups, wireless Samsung DeX support, option to hide the status bar while browsing, edit and delete multiple contacts, trash bin for recently deleted messages, sound detectors that now work with SmartThings devices, separate profiles for personal and work usage, and other Bixby routines.

Previously, Samsung has released the roadmap schedule of the One UI 3.0 in Egypt. Among the devices slated for the January 2021 release is the Note 10, Note 20, Z Flip, Z Fold2, and the S10 series.
